Understanding EV Charger Installation in Hell’s Kitchen
Installing an EV charger, whether it’s a Level 1 (standard outlet) or a more powerful Level 2 charger, requires specialized knowledge and adherence to strict electrical codes. Local electricians in Hell’s Kitchen are well-equipped to handle these installations, understanding the unique challenges presented by the borough’s varied building stock, from historic brownstones to modern high-rises. The process typically involves an assessment of your home’s electrical panel capacity, determining the optimal location for the charger, and running the necessary wiring. Given the dense urban environment of Hell’s Kitchen, experienced electricians will also consider factors such as public sidewalk access, potential permit requirements, and aesthetic integration into the building’s facade.
The Installation Process A Step-by-Step Overview
While the specifics can vary, a typical EV charger installation in Hell’s Kitchen involves several key stages:
- Initial Consultation and Site Assessment: A qualified electrician will visit your property to evaluate your existing electrical system, discuss your EV charging needs, and recommend the most suitable charger type and placement.
- Electrical Panel Upgrade (if necessary): Many older buildings in Hell’s Kitchen, accustomed to lower electrical demands, might require an electrical panel upgrade to safely accommodate the power draw of a Level 2 charger.
- Wiring and Conduit Installation: The electrician will run the necessary electrical wiring from your panel to the charger’s location, often utilizing conduit for protection.
- Charger Mounting and Connection: The charger unit will be securely mounted, and the electrical connections will be made by the licensed professional.
- Testing and Inspection: The charger will be thoroughly tested to ensure it’s functioning correctly and safely. Permits and inspections may be required by the NYC Department of Buildings.
Common Electrical Considerations for Hell’s Kitchen Properties
Hell’s Kitchen presents a unique set of electrical considerations for EV charger installations:
- Amperage Requirements: Level 2 chargers typically require a dedicated 20-amp or 40-amp circuit, necessitating a robust electrical system.
- Service Panel Capacity: Many older buildings may have outdated service panels with limited capacity, potentially requiring an upgrade.
- Wiring Runs: Navigating the existing wiring infrastructure of older buildings can be complex, requiring skilled electricians.
- Conduit Requirements: To protect the wiring from physical damage and to comply with code, the use of electrical conduit is often mandatory, especially for outdoor installations.
- Ground Fault Circuit Interrupter (GFCI) Protection: GFCI protection is crucial for EV charging circuits, particularly in areas exposed to moisture.

Estimated EV Charger Installation Costs in Hell’s Kitchen, NY
The cost of EV charger installation can vary based on several factors, including the type of charger, the complexity of the electrical work required, and whether any electrical panel upgrades are necessary. The following table provides an estimated cost range for common EV charger installation services in Hell’s Kitchen.
| Service | Estimated Cost Range (USD) |
|---|---|
| Level 1 Charger Installation (using existing outlet) | $200 – $600 |
| Level 2 Charger Installation (basic) | $800 – $1,800 |
| Level 2 Charger Installation (with electrical panel upgrade/significant wiring) | $1,500 – $4,000+ |
| Permit Fees (if applicable) | $100 – $500+ |
Please note: These are estimates and actual costs may vary. It is always recommended to obtain detailed quotes from multiple licensed electricians.
Frequently Asked Questions About EV Charger Installation
What is the difference between a Level 1 and Level 2 EV charger, and which is right for my Hell’s Kitchen home?
A Level 1 charger uses a standard 120-volt outlet and provides a slower charging speed, typically adding about 4-5 miles of range per hour. It’s suitable if you have short commutes and can charge overnight. A Level 2 charger uses a 240-volt outlet and charges significantly faster, adding 20-30 miles of range per hour. For most Hell’s Kitchen residents with daily driving needs, or those living in apartments or townhouses where charging might be less frequent, a Level 2 charger is generally recommended for its speed and convenience. Our local electricians can help assess your specific needs and electrical capacity to make the best recommendation.
Will I need a permit for EV charger installation in Hell’s Kitchen?
Yes, in most cases, installing a Level 2 EV charger in New York City, including Hell’s Kitchen, will require obtaining permits from the NYC Department of Buildings. This ensures the installation is safe and meets all local codes. Licensed electricians are familiar with the permitting process and can assist you with obtaining the necessary approvals. Attempting installation without a permit can lead to fines and pose safety risks.
My Hell’s Kitchen apartment building has limited electrical capacity. Can I still install an EV charger?
It’s a common concern in older buildings throughout Hell’s Kitchen. If your building’s electrical capacity is insufficient for a Level 2 charger, an electrical panel upgrade may be necessary. This involves assessing your current service and potentially increasing its amperage. In some co-op or condo buildings, you may also need approval from the building management or board. A qualified electrician can perform an assessment and advise on the feasibility and cost of such upgrades.
